Italian[edit]

Etymology[edit]

Borrowed from Medieval Latin retentīvus, from Latin retentus. Doublet of ritentivo.

Pronunciation[edit]

  • IPA(key): /re.tenˈti.vo/
  • Rhymes: -ivo
  • Hyphenation: re‧ten‧tì‧vo

Adjective[edit]

retentivo (feminine retentiva, masculine plural retentivi, feminine plural retentive)

  1. (physics) retentive

Spanish[edit]

Etymology[edit]

Borrowed from Medieval Latin retentīvus, from Latin retentus.

Pronunciation[edit]

  • IPA(key): /retenˈtibo/ [re.t̪ẽn̪ˈt̪i.β̞o]
  • Rhymes: -ibo
  • Syllabification: re‧ten‧ti‧vo

Adjective[edit]

retentivo (feminine retentiva, masculine plural retentivos, feminine plural retentivas)

  1. retentive
